From the sun's rays to the plant to you.

An antioxidant responsible for the red, yellow, and orange colors in some fruits and vegetables, beta carotene converts to vitamin A in the body and plays a number of important roles in your overall health.

Committed to crafting supplements that just work better, Solaray Plant Source Food Carotene‚ provides 10,000 IU of vitamin A as 100% natural beta carotene from algae per 1-softgel serving. Additionally, we include a powerful carotenoid complex of annatto oil, carrot concentrate, lemon grass, spirulina, and yam. Together, the ingredients in our Food Carotene‚ formula are designed to help support normal, healthy skin and eyes, antioxidant activity, and immune system function.

Directions:Use only as directed. Take 1 softgel daily with a meal or glass of water. Store in a cool, dry place

Ingredients: 1 Capsule supplies:
Vitamin A 500 mcg
100% as Natural Beta Carotene [Dunaliella salina (algae)]
(10,000 IU of Vitamin A)
Carotenoid Complex 6 mg

Other Ingredients: Olive Oil, Softgel (Gelatin, Glycerin and Beeswax), Lecithin (soy) and Titanium Dioxide.

Health Benefits of Food Carotene 500 mcg (10,000 IU)

  1. Supports Eye Health: Carotene is a precursor to vitamin A, which is essential for maintaining good vision and eye health. It helps in preventing night blindness and age-related macular degeneration.
  2. Boosts Immune System: Vitamin A derived from carotene plays a crucial role in supporting the immune system by enhancing the body's ability to fight infections and illnesses.
  3. Antioxidant Properties: Carotene acts as an antioxidant in the body, helping to neutralize harmful free radicals that can cause cellular damage and contribute to chronic diseases.
  4. Healthy Skin: Vitamin A is known for its role in maintaining healthy skin by promoting cell turnover and supporting skin repair processes. Carotene can help in improving skin texture and overall appearance.
  5. Supports Bone Health: Carotene contributes to bone health by aiding in the absorption of calcium and promoting bone growth and development.
